Great SUV for all aspects!!!
I have owned the original X3 and followed up with this model. The second generation is certainly a few steps above as far as comfort, style and driving performance. 2012 is the last year the 28i is powered by the 3.0L inline 6. Acceleration is great after getting the software update. Prior to it, I had the aggravating slow response met with a rush of acceleration. The software update has smoothed out the throttle greatly. The ride is super comfortable for day to day as well as trips. I have taken this car on long trips a few times this year and it is great on gas, very comfortable seats and great visibility. It is easy to park and has a tight turning circle. The handling feels like the 3 series sedan! Going up and down hills and mountainsides feels secure. Feature wise, I fully recommend the backup camera and parking sensors as well as the heated seats/steering wheel. Cargo space is adequate for this class and three average sized adults can fit in the backseat comfortably. I will say that BMW has this peculiar way of stripping the cars down in the past 10 years and labeling it as "customization." You notice the small things such as no puddle lights on my particular car, as well as having to get packages for an improved interior/exterior. Another example is if you do not get the Navigation, you do not get the nicely done, upscale graphics on the speedometer area. You have to add leather, a sunroof, heated seats, etc. My older BMW's had a lot of these more common features standard. If you buy this car used, be sure to pay attention to the features and how it was optioned. Overall, the car has been very reliable and a joy to drive!

This is the most underrated gems in the used diesel SUV
This is the most underrated gems in the used diesel SUV market—but only if you’re the right kind of owner. Powered by the soon becoming legendary M57 inline-six diesel engine, this version of the E70 X5 combines German engineering with long-haul durability if treated right….and by treated right, I mean ideally maintained by someone who can turn a wrench and not the type of owner who wants to drop it off at the dealership for every noise or light. This vehicle is ideal for the hands-on car enthusiast who appreciates the mechanical integrity of a proper diesel engine and doesn’t mind putting in garage time to keep it in good shape. If you're someone who already loves BMWs and understands their quirks, this vehicle will feel like a rewarding project and a fantastic daily driver in one package. The M57 diesel engine is incredibly robust and becomes one of the best engines only with one huge caveat…the emissions equipment needs to be removed. In fact, I would not recommend owning this vehicle if you don’t plan or cannot do this in your state legally. Once deleted, this engine opens up and delivers a strong blend of torque, horse power and efficiency, making it an excellent tow vehicle. It's perfect for hauling a car trailer, camper, or family gear around without struggle. Stock, it’s already torquey, but with the deletes and a mild tune, this becomes a real beast without sacrificing reliability...and if given a race tune, this thing will hurt other drivers' feelings pulling from stop lights or on the freeway. The chassis overall is “decent” (Being said by a vintage BMW enthusiast, this is very much a compliment to today’s standards), but there are known maintenance pain points that a mechanically inclined owner should be aware of. If you plan to purchase from a used dealership or private seller, you’ll most likely need to do a suspension refresh including replacement of struts, bushings, arms etc.…possibly an engine refresh including valve cover seals, intake manifold cleaning and replacement of other various leaky seals…work on the cooling system including but not limited to replacing lines, hoses, main/expansion coolant tank as these are plastic and will crack and fail due to heat over time. There will be some normal interior wear including the finishes of center console buttons peeling off but are easily replaceable. Something important to note when purchasing is the interior sunroof shade condition, including whether it is completely operable and if there are any signs of sagging/peeling fabric. Any issue with the sunroof should reflect in the price as this item is very intricate, expensive, and difficult to work on. These aren’t dealbreakers though...just things to note when looking to purchase and if they’ve been covered in recent maintenance...if they haven't, plan for work that will inevitably need to be done. Again, don’t expect it to be hands-off, you’ve got to earn this one…But if you're up for the task, you’ll be rewarded with one of BMW’s most versatile platforms.

Very good, with a couple of caveats
2020 X1 w/sport seats and convenience package, purchased in 2023. Positive notes: It's a true BMW: sure-footed, agile, and no shortage of power when needed. It feels remarkably glued to the road despite its small size. Handles as well as my former 3 series and is just as fun to drive. Storage space is good. Ergonomics are good once you figure out all the technology. Negatives: Ride is a bit bumpy, even for a sporty car, which is apparently caused by the run-flat tires. If I was buying new, I'd get standard tires and a real spare, which fits in the storage space in the back. Sensatec seats are hot. In retrospect, I'd hold out for leather. Overall, I recommend this car if you're looking for something small, practical, full-featured and sporty.

2012 x5 35d ,180,000 no issues so far
2012 X5 35D. Over 180,000 Miles with very few repairs, I noticed some reviews on here seem to be for the gas version wich I wouldn't recommend due to repair /maintenance cost. I get around 24_25mpg with it plenty fast ,I also tow 2 motorcycles on a 3 rail bike trailer ,still get 22 mpg and you don't really even notice that the trailer and bikes are there, Comfy ,stylish , great torque fir a mid size suv. I plan to buy another and sell my current one around 200k.
